Caledonia State Park hosts 34th Annual Arts and Crafts Fair


FAYETTEVILLE - Approximately 150 crafters and artists will display their wares.on Saturday, July 9, at Caledonia State Park's 34th Annual Arts and Crafts Fair, 9 a.m.-4 p.m. at the park, 101 Pine Grove Road, Fayetteville.

Admission is free. Spend the day browsing through the unique variety of crafts ranging from jewelry, pottery, baskets, Indian and southwestern crafts to birdhouses, handcrafted furniture and more.

Entertainment will be provided by Nancy and Jody “Island Fusion” band and Gad Abouts Square Dance Club.

Island Fusion will perform 9-11 a.m. and  noon -1 p.m. with steel drums, keyboards, guitar, drums and vocals featuring the music of the islands, Jimmy Buffett, classic rock, R&B and swing.  Gad Abouts Square Dance Club will perform 11 a.m.-noon and from 1-2 p.m.

A variety of sandwiches, baked goods, french fries, ice cream and sodas will be available at the concession stand at the pool and through the King Street U.B. Sunday school classes.  .

Environmental Interpretive Technician Wesley Foltz will be offering free samples of old style homemade root beer, made from natural ingredients, at the pool patio from 1-3 p.m.

Also, the Thaddeus Stevens Blacksmith Shop will be open from 9 a.m.- 4 p.m., with Ross Hetrick portraying Thaddeus Stevens. The PA Forest Fire and Heritage Museum is scheduled to be open from 1-5 p.m., and the PA Woodmobile will be on site.
